The following information lists the population statistics and breakdown for the 66845 zip code. The total population is 1053, of which, 562 are male and 491 are female. With a total area of 390.714 square miles, the population density is 2.8 people per square mile. The median age of the population is 46.3 years old. The median inflation-adjusted family income in the 66845 zip code is $59821. This is -12.83% less than the national average. This income places 6.6% of the population below the poverty line. The average retirement income for individuals in this zip code (for those that have it) is $16004. In the 66845 zip code, 92.4% of individuals over 25 years old have a high school degree or higher, and 29.1% have a bachelors degree or higher. In the 66845 zip, there are an estimated 566 people in the labor force, of which, 557 are employed, and 9 are unemployed. There are a total of 0 people in the armed forces. The average commute time for this zip code is 21.6 minutes. Of the total people that work, 87 worked from home and 553 commuted. The average number of hours worked is 39.7. The median home value for the 66845 zip code is 92900. There is an estimated 451 number of occupied housing units, the median gross rent in is $525 per month, and the average monthly housing costs are estimated to be $625.
